A state of complete physical, mental, and social wellness and not merely the absence of disease or
infirmity. - ANSWER>>Health
An individual's personal journey toward the mental, physical, social, and emotional betterment of life. -
ANSWER>>Wellness
The active process of applying learned and developed strategies that lead to mental, physical, social, and
emotional changes for a better quality of life. - ANSWER>>Wellness Coaching
An area of scientific study of psychology that focuses on maximizing personal strength and potential (in
contrast to correcting shortcomings) in the pursuit of a better quality of life. It places emphasis on
positive individual traits, institutions, and a person's subjective wellness. - ANSWER>>Positive
Psychology
Salute meaning "health" and genesis meaning "beginning." - ANSWER>>Salutogenesis
When positive emotions lead to self-perpetuating adherence to positive healthy behaviors. -
ANSWER>>Upward Spirals
The onset of a self-perpetuating damaging cycle due to negative emotions. - ANSWER>>Downward
Spirals
Experiencing a reoccurring thought that is about the same idea or event; often, these thoughts are
negative in nature. - ANSWER>>Rumination
Any stimulus or situation that causes a deflection from homeostatic balance. - ANSWER>>Stressors
Feedback highlighting behaviors and outcomes to be reinforced as they increase the likelihood of goal
attainment. - ANSWER>>Positive Feedback
